What is multimedia WSN?

As a result, Wireless Multimedia Sensor Network (WMSN) [6] is a network of wirelessly interconnected sensor nodes equipped with multimedia devices, such as cameras and microphones, and capable to retrieve video and audio streams, still images, as well as scalar sensor data.

What is WSN explain the application examples of WSN?

Area monitoring is a common application of WSNs. In area monitoring, the WSN is deployed over a region where some phenomenon is to be monitored. A military example is the use of sensors to detect enemy intrusion; a civilian example is the geo-fencing of gas or oil pipelines.

What are the types of WSN?

Classification of Wireless Sensor Networks

  • Static and Mobile WSN.
  • Deterministic and Nondeterministic WSN.
  • Single Base Station and Multi Base Station WSN.
  • Static Base Station and Mobile Base Station WSN.
  • Single-hop and Multi-hop WSN.
  • Self – Reconfigurable and Non – Self – Configurable WSN.
  • Homogeneous and Heterogeneous WSN.

What is terrestrial WSN?

Terrestrial Wireless Sensor Networks: Terrestrial WSNs are used for communicating base stations efficiently, and comprise thousands of wireless sensor nodes deployed either in an unstructured (ad hoc) or structured (Pre-planned) manner.

What are the characteristics of WSN?

3. Characteristics of WSN

  • Power consumption limitations for sensor nodes.
  • Ability to cope with failures of nodes.
  • Mobility of nodes.
  • Heterogeneity of nodes.
  • Homogeneity of nodes.
  • Ability to deploy on a large scale.
  • Capability to survive harsh environmental conditions.
  • Helps to use easily.

Which is a one of the most popular wireless technology is used by WSN?

Wireless M-Bus and KNX RF Multi are standards optimized for battery operation. The most common operating frequency is 868 MHz, giving better range than solutions based on 2.45 GHz.

How are sensor networks beneficial in healthcare?

Embedded in a variety of medical instruments for use at hospitals, clinics, and homes, sensors provide patients and their healthcare providers insight into physiological and physical health states that are critical to the detection, diagnosis, treatment, and management of ailments.

What are the challenges of multimedia WSN?

Multi-media sensor nodes are typically deployed in a pre- planned manner into the environment to guarantee coverage. Challenges in such WSN include high bandwidth demand, high energy consumption, quality of service (QoS) provisioning, data processing and compressing techniques, and cross-layer design.

What is Battlefield Surveillance in military?

During conflict, the battlefield surveillance mission is to detect, locate, identify, and monitor changes in the enemy’s resources: tanks and other vehicles, helicopters, motorized troops, air defense batteries, etc. It must enable target acquisition for the artillery or for tactical aviation forces.

How structural health monitoring is performed by a WSN?

By using Microelectromechanical Systems (MEMS) Accelerometer we can perform Structural Health Monitoring by studying the dynamic response through measure of ambient vibrations and strong motion of such structures.
